新型开路短路枝节加载三频带通滤波器

摘要: 采用开路短路枝节加载开环谐振器,设计了一种新型的3个通带中心频率独立可调的三频带通滤波器.由于谐振器的结构对称,因此采用传统的奇偶模分析法.滤波器的第一和第三通带由偶模谐振频率产生,通过改变加载枝节的电长度和阻抗比可调节偶模谐振频率.滤波器的第二通带由奇模谐振频率产生,通过改变环的电长度和阻抗可调节奇模谐振频率.该滤波器的3个通带中心频率为1.57GHz(GPS),2.4GHz (WLAN)和3.5GHz (WIMAX), 3dB带宽分别为2.5%, 4.7%和2.0%,测量结果与电磁仿真结果基本吻合.

Abstract: A tri-band bandpass filter has been designed using open-loop resonator with open and short stubs. The filter can control each center frequency independently. An odd-even mode analysis is performed on the resonator. The center frequencies of the first and third passbands are obtained with the even mode, and determined by the electrical length and impedance ratio of the stubs. The center frequency of the second passband is obtained with the odd mode and determined by the electrical length and impedance of the open-loop. The filter has triple passband center frequencies of 1.57 GHz for GPS, 2.4 GHz for WLAN, and 3.5GHz for WIMAX, with 3dB fractional bandwidths of 2.5%, 4.7%, and 2.0% , respectively. Measurement results are in general agreement with EM simulation results.
